• I WOULD like to say many thanks for publishing the story on my brother Terry McLarty (‘Beep beep!’ Tributes to ‘Big T’, March 9).
Terry was a park groundsman at Cantelowes open space in Camden Town where he was known as “Big T”.
As a brother he was larger than life, always havin’ fun and – yes loved his music, like the rest of us. And he was always loved in the family. He was one of three brothers born in Tooting, south west London.
I am the oldest of the three, but I’ve lived in Plymouth for 15 years now. But I always get back in Tooting for my mum’s birthday in August.
There is to be a memorial bench for him and I will visit the park and members of staff there and maybe friends who got to know him. That will be in August.
